Expert accident investigators

An accident investigator will be utilized by a lawyer for truck injury attorney truck accidents to determine who was at fault for the accident. The accident investigator will examine various areas. For instance, he might request to examine the driver's qualifications file of the truck driver. The file should include the driver's driving records as well as his education and employment history as well as hours of service records and truck accident lawsuits injury attorney maintenance records for the vehicle.

It is crucial to engage an accident investigator as quickly as you can following the accident. Accidents can occur for a variety reasons, and the reason may not be apparent immediately. Understanding the rules

Accidents involving trucks are a major problem for the industry. Since the number of trucking accidents rises each year, trucking lawyers need to have knowledge of trucking regulations in order to effectively represent their clients. Truck drivers and the entire trucking industry are regulated by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). It also has strict rules for truck drivers, for example, having a rest period after every eight hours of driving.
